3. CONTENT DESCRIPTION

Nature of Science

  • Approach to “Nature of Science” for Education
  • Explicit and Implicit teaching of Nature of Science
  • Views of Nature of Science (Teaching and learning implications)
  • Nature of Science tasks for Primary Education

 History of Science

  • The role of History of Science for teaching and learning Sciences
  • Some examples for Primary Education

 Science education resources, methodologies and trends

  • Inquiry-based learning

What is IBL

Teachers´ competencies for IBL implementation

IBL tasks (II)

  • Practical work for Science Education
  • Interdisciplinariety
  • Technology for Science Education

Significant context embedded in electronic resources

Case study: Simulations

Chemistry and Physics in Primary education

  • Forces (misconceptions, strategies, practical work and related concepts) in Primary Education
  • Matter and material properties (misconceptions, strategies, practical work and related concepts) in Primary Education)
  • Energy (misconceptions, strategies, practical work and related concepts) in Primary Education

Assesment Criteria (explicit)

  • To know and apply scientific knowledge (physics and chemistry) to explain the natural phenomena
  • To know main learning progressions in Primary Education to teach and learn "Chemistry & Phisics" concepts, facts and phenomena. 
  • To identify and appropriately solves problems associated with science relatited to everyday life events.
  • To know and  to value the way in which science builds knowledge, and the evolution of scientific theories over time (Nature of Science)
  • To identify, describe and critically analyze naive and adequate  views of Science
  • To  design and evaluate appropriate teaching resources for Science Education in Priamry School
  • To know and apply appropriate methodological resources and strategies to promote the acquisition of scientific competences in primary school students.
